India has taken a significant step toward enhancing public safety with the nationwide rollout of a cell broadcast alert system, launched by Jyotiraditya Scindia. The initiative, led by the Department of Telecommunications, aims to deliver real-time emergency notifications directly to mobile users during natural disasters and critical events. A recent trial run triggered widespread alerts across devices, accompanied by official communication urging citizens not to panic. The system reflects India’s growing emphasis on indigenous technology, digital infrastructure, and proactive disaster management, with potential implications for governance efficiency and public safety outcomes.
A Strategic Leap in Disaster Communication
The launch of the cell broadcast alert system marks a transformative development in India’s disaster management framework. Unlike traditional SMS-based alerts, the system enables instant, location-specific communication to millions of users simultaneously, ensuring faster dissemination of critical information.
This capability is particularly vital in a country prone to diverse natural disasters, including floods, cyclones, and earthquakes. By leveraging advanced telecommunications infrastructure, authorities can now reach affected populations in real time, potentially mitigating risks and saving lives.
Trial Run and Public Response
Ahead of the nationwide rollout, the Department of Telecommunications conducted a trial on April 29 to familiarize citizens with the system. The test message, labeled as an “Extremely Severe Alert,” was broadcast across mobile devices, prompting widespread attention.
To prevent confusion, officials had заранее issued advisories clarifying that the alerts were part of a controlled test and required no public action. The proactive communication strategy highlights the importance of managing public perception during the introduction of new technologies.
Indigenous Technology and Digital Sovereignty
A notable aspect of the initiative is its reliance on indigenous technology. By developing and deploying a homegrown solution, India reinforces its commitment to digital sovereignty and self-reliance in critical infrastructure.
This approach not only reduces dependency on external systems but also enables greater customization to meet local requirements. It aligns with broader national priorities of promoting innovation and strengthening domestic technological capabilities.
Governance, Efficiency, and Public Safety
The cell broadcast system represents a convergence of technology and governance, enhancing the state’s ability to respond to emergencies effectively. Real-time alerts can facilitate quicker evacuations, improve coordination among agencies, and reduce the impact of disasters.
From a policy perspective, such systems contribute to building resilient communities by ensuring that critical information reaches citizens without delay. The initiative underscores the role of digital infrastructure in modern governance.
